Ancient cannon found at Sanam Luang
Published: 25/08/2018 at 07:46 PM
Online news: https://www.bangkokpost.com/news/genera ... recent_box


A cannon believed to be around 200 years old has been uncovered in the middle of Sanam Luang in Bangkok.

Thai media reported the cannon might have dated back to the reign of King Rama II (1809 to 1824). It is 3.05m long with a 40cm muzzle.
